ORDER

This petition is filed by the petitioner to direct the second respondent to provide adequate police protection to the petitioner.

2. According to the petitioner, he received a life threat from the third respondent and thereby, he sent a representation on 11.03.2024 and the same has not been considered so far. Hence, filed this petition.

3. The learned counsel appearing for the third respondent submits that no such occurrence had taken place as alleged by the petitioner. There is a dispute with respect to the property and thereby, police protection cannot be granted.

4. The learned Government Advocate (crl.side) appearing for the respondents 1 and 2, on instructions, submits that the representation of the petitioner has been considered and the same has also been closed. Therefore, nothing survives for further adjudication in this petition. 2/4

5. Considering the prayer sought for in this petition and the representation of the petitioner has already been considered and closed by the second respondent, nothing survives for further adjudication in this petition. Therefore, this Criminal Original Petition is closed. More over, there is a property dispute between the parties.
